20100144312 | LIMITING DATA TRANSMISSION TO AND/OR FROM A COMMUNICATION DEVICE AS A DATA TRANSMISSION CAP IS APPROACHED AND GRAPHICAL USER INTERFACE FOR CONFIGURING SAME - A data transmission cap represents a maximum amount of data that can be transmitted to and/or from a communication device during a subscriber billing cycle without incurring a penalty under a subscriber rate plan. To limit data transmission to and/or from the communication device as the data transmission cap is approached, a graphical user interface (GUI) is displayed. The GUI includes one or more GUI controls for selecting a data transmission limiting tactic from a plurality of distinct data transmission limiting tactics and for specifying a data transmission threshold at which the selected tactic is to take effect, the threshold being below the operative cap. Upon user interaction with the GUI control(s), user input indicating the selected data transmission tactic and specified data transmission threshold is received. The communication device or another electronic device in communication therewith is configured to effect the selected data transmission limiting tactic when the specified data transmission threshold is reached. | 06-10-2010 |

20100235215 | METHOD AND COMPUTING DEVICE FOR UPDATING A CALENDAR DATABASE STORING EVENT DATA ASSOCIATED WITH AN EVENT, USING A WAITLIST - A method and computing device for updating a calendar database storing event data associated with an event are provided. The event data comprises identifiers of invitees to the event and a maximum number of attendees for the event. The computing device is in communication with the calendar database. Event request data is transmitted to respective invitee computing devices associated with the invitees, the event request data requesting respective responses from the invitee computing devices, each respective response comprising one of a positive response indicative that the event will be attended and a negative response indicative that the event will not be attended. Respective positive responses are received from at least a subset of the invitee computing devices. The event data is updated, based on the positive responses, to maintain a first list of identifiers of attendees. If a number of attendees equals the maximum number, and at least one subsequent positive response is received, then: the event data is updated, based on the at least one subsequent positive response, to maintain a second list of identifiers of waitlisted invitees for the event; and a waiting-list notification is transmitted, to each one of the invitee computing devices associated with the second list, the waiting list notification indicative that an invitee associated with one of the invitee computing devices associated with the second list is on a waiting list. | 09-16-2010 |
20100278162 | METHOD OF MAINTAINING DATA COLLECTIONS IN A MOBILE COMMUNICATION DEVICE - A mobile device configured to communicate with one or more various enterprise services and Internet services. Such services include such features as e-mail, calendar, and personal information management (PIM). The mobile device is configured to maintain a distinction between each of these services by having a number of databases, each database dedicated to a specific service. To facilitate this distinction, a service identifier is generated with respect to each database. When a service is removed, the mobile device no longer has access to the service. In such an instance, the mobile device is configured to maintain the associated database and the service identifier. Should a removed service become reactivated for the mobile device, the maintained database will become re-associated with the proper service by using the service identifier. By distinguishing between databases using the service identifiers, the mobile device may prevent “cross-pollination” between its databases when synchronizing with different services. | 11-04-2010 |

20120030194 | IDENTIFICATION AND SCHEDULING OF EVENTS ON A COMMUNICATION DEVICE - A method, communication device and system are provided for identifying and scheduling events, such as meetings and appointments identified in data items such as messages and electronic documents. Content relating to an event is identified within the data item, and date information for the identified event is determined based on the content of the data item or other contextual information. An availability status in respect of the event is determined by querying a data store, such as a calendar store, to determine whether the date and time associated with the identified event is free or in conflict. Once the availability status is determined, the data item may be displayed at the communication device together with a visual indicator of the availability status. The identified event in the data item may be actuatable to create an event item for storage in the data store. | 02-02-2012 |
